Do you Have a Problem with your Steering?

Posted on October 30, 2017 at 10:24 pm

Steering issues are relatively common in cars. They can be dangerous if they progress to far, so it’s important to make sure you get the issue checked out as soon as it appear. This is important for the safety of you, your passengers and other road users. Here are some of the things to look out for:

  • Liquid underneath the vehicle. This could be indicative of a leaking power steering system. Check to see if you can spot where the liquid is coming from.
  • A crunching or grinding sound when steering. This could be a problem with plates inside the steering system, or it could be indicative of a lack of power steering fluid.
  • The car doesn’t seem to be moving the way you want it to. This could be an issue with wheel alignment, rather than the steering itself. It also could be a problem with your tyres, so get these checked first.

What Should you do if you Car is Damaged by Someone Else?

Posted on September 26, 2017 at 2:20 pm

Often, damage to your car will not be your fault. Someone might cause you to have a car accident through their driving, or they may damage your vehicle accidentally whilst parking or driving round a corner. This is what you should do in these circumstances:

  • Get the other person’s details. Ask for a name, contact number and insurance details. They should either cover the cost of the damage themselves or they should use their insurance policy to cover it.
  • Make a note of their registration. This is especially important if you think that they might drive off without owning up to the damage they have caused to your vehicle.
  • Find a local garage and get some quotes. If the person is paying for the damage privately, get some quotes so you know what they will owe you.

If you find your care has been damaged whilst you are away from it, get some quotes. You could claim on your insurance but if the damage is minimal, it may be cheaper in the long run to repair it yourself.

Choosing a Car Based on your Needs

Posted on September 1, 2017 at 12:57 am

A car is one of the most important purchases you will ever make. It will be one of the most expensive things you own, for starters (probably the only thing more expensive will be your house). It’s therefore imperative that you make the right decision when choosing your next vehicle.

Weigh up the pros and cons of different models. If you want a car that looks stylish and modern, think about a sports car. However, make sure this is a practical choice for you. A people carrier may be more suitable for you if you have 3 children and 2 dogs!

That’s not to say that there isn’t a compromise. Many cars, like landrovers and rangerovers, are now seen as something of a fashionable brand. New models of these cars have been brought out to appeal to younger people who crave style and elegance. See what deals can be done on brands like these.

Renting a Car Out in the UK

Posted on July 17, 2017 at 11:46 pm

Renting a car is often something that people do on holiday, but it may also be necessary to rent a car in the UK from time to time. If this is the case, make sure you know what your rights are before you rent a car. Here are some things to think about:

• You should be able to take out your own insurance. If a company claims you have to take out their insurance policy, they are just trying to make more money out of you. Avoid companies like this.
• You should be provided with a spar tyre. There should be a spare tyre on any vehicle you rent so make sure it is there and make sure it is adequate.
• Make sure you know how much fuel needs to be in the vehicle when you return it. You should not have to return it with more fuel than you receive it with, so make a note of how full the tank is.

Taking Out a Contract for Breakdown Cover

Posted on February 25, 2017 at 5:10 pm

Breakdown cover can come in incredibly useful for car owners and people who use company cars. It will ensure that you’re always able to get yourself out of difficult situations on the road where you might otherwise end up being stranded. It’s something that you should seriously consider for your vehicle.

Many different companies offer breakdown cover and there will be lots of different levels. This means it is a service that can work for all budgets. Explore the different options and find one that is right for you. Some companies will also offer services like driveway cover, so that if your car won’t start, you can give them a call then as well.

The main benefit of breakdown cover is peace of mind. You will know that you are covered wherever you are and whatever you might be doing. If you have a company car, speak to your boss or fleet manager to ensure that you have some form of breakdown cover.
